I have said many times that I love the Psalms. I’m a big fan of David’s. We have a lot in common. Not that I’m a giant slayer (not in the physical sense anyway), but I have made my own share of mistakes and been granted mercy on many occasions…for which I am tremendously grateful.

This is one of my favorite verses from David after he had once again been in a bad spot:

Psalm 51:10, “Create in me a clean heart, O God, and renew a steadfast spirit within me.”

I tell my girls all the time, specially Heidi (6yo) “Don’t worry about what others are doing around you. You are only responsible for your own words and your own actions.” It’s a hard lesson to comprehend as a child…and really not much easier as an adult when you feel like someone is really getting away with it; living the dream without really “earning” it. Watching people “cheat” their way to the top is never fun.

But God sees it all. And he looks on our heart.

So today, I ask God to give me a clean heart…a clean slate to start over once again. And let’s do this. Great things are ahead for each of us, but we can’t move forward until we clean out the clutter!
